Radiologic Technologist and Technician Hourly Pay in Centennial, CO: $50.07 (2026)
Quick Answer:Hourly pay for a radiologic technologist and technician working in Centennial, CO runs $50.07 at the median for 2026 — annualizing to $104,130 at a standard 2,080-hour year. Figures projected from BLS OEWS 2025 (SOC 29-2034). Weighted against Centennial's regional price level (BEA RPP 105.0, 5% above national), each hour of work buys what $47.68 nationally would. A 24-hour part-time schedule grosses $62,482 per year.
Based on BLS state-level estimates · View source

Radiologic technologists and technicians in Centennial, Colorado, earn a median hourly rate of $50.07, significantly surpassing the national median of $40.55. This competitive pay highlights the opportunities available for both full-time and part-time professionals in various workplace settings, such as hospital imaging suites, outpatient centers, and mobile X-ray units. For part-time workers, particularly those on a three-day workweek schedule, this rate provides a solid income. The hourly range for entry-level technologists starts at $33.23, while experienced professionals can earn as much as $77.60, illustrating the potential for growth within this field based on skill and specialization.

Radiologic Technologist and Technician Hourly Wage Breakdown
| Percentile | Hourly Rate | Per 8hr Shift |
|---|---|---|
| Entry Level (P10) | $33.23 | $265.84 |
| Lower Range (P25) | $38.93 | $311.41 |
| Median (P50) | $50.07 | $400.52 |
| Upper Range (P75) | $60.88 | $487.03 |
| Top Earners (P90) | $77.60 | $620.79 |

Hourly Rate Trajectory for Radiologic Technologists and Technicians in Centennial (2019–2027)
2019–2025: actual BLS OEWS data for this metro area. 2026+: CAGR 5.29% projection.
| Year | Hourly Rate | Status |
|---|---|---|
| 2019 | $35.92/hr | Actual |
| 2020 | $36.74/hr | Actual |
| 2021 | $36.43/hr | Actual |
| 2022 | $38.66/hr | Actual |
| 2023 | $43.57/hr | Actual |
| 2024 | $40.13/hr | Actual |
| 2025 | $47.55/hr | Actual |
| 2026(current) | $50.07/hr | Estimated |
| 2027 | $52.71/hr | Projected |
Based on 7 years of BLS OEWS metropolitan area data, the median hourly rate for radiologic technologists and technicians in Centennial grew 32.4% from $35.92/hr (2019) to $47.55/hr (2025). At a 5.29% projected growth rate, hourly pay is expected to reach $52.71/hr by 2027. Working as an Hourly Radiologic Technologist and Technician in Centennial
In Centennial, part-time radiologic technologists and technicians working 24 hours a week can expect to earn a yearly income that reflects their hourly earnings, translating to approximately $62,488 annually. The per-diem landscape provides an alternative income path, with such workers billing anywhere from $40 to $60 per hour, depending on their specific skills and the demand for services. Cross-trained professionals, particularly those proficient in CT or MRI, might command even higher rates ranging from $50 to $75 per hour. However, choices about work environments affect pay, with hospital imaging departments generally offering benefits but potentially lower hourly rates compared to private outpatient centers or mobile units, which might provide higher pay without benefits.
